Last Dance



Sunlight streams through window pane unto a spot on the floor.... then I remember, it's where you used to lie, but now you are no more.
Our feet walk down a hall of carpet, and muted echoes sound.... then I remember, It's where your paws would joyously abound.
A voice is heard along the road, and up beyond the hill, then I remember it can't be yours.... your golden voice is still.
But I'll take that vacant spot of floor and empty muted hall and lay them with the absent voice and unused dish along the wall.
I'll wrap these treasured memorials in a blanket of my love and keep them for my best friend until we meet above.

Author Unknown.
For Blizten, who collapsed and died yesterday while chasing a ball in the park. I only knew Blitzen and his mum Marilyn for a bit over a year. He always made me smile with his charming way of scamming treats from everyone. A cuddly teddy bear of a dog, an athlete and a freestyle champion.
For our best friends, we can hope for nothing less than for them to be taken while doing what they love, without suffering or long term ill health. However what is best for them is often hardest on us. We know from the day we get our dogs as tiny puppies that one day our hearts will be broken. We always hope that it is later rather than sooner. But it is always too soon. No matter how much time we have with them, it's never enough. Never enough time to tell them how much we love them once more or give them just one more hug. I really believe though that they KNOW.
Blitzen, you were taken from the world much too soon. You will be missed by everyone but especially by Marilyn. Thoughts are with you my friend.
I know you are dancing your paws off at the Rainbow Bridge.
